Vance G:
When making creamed honey I put about 1 part to 10 seed and a heaping tablespoon of cinnamon per total pounds.  Adjust from there.  Very popular item for my honey sales. 

Bakersdozen:
I have made habanero honey numerous times.  I chop up about 4 habaneros per cup of honey I slowly heat on the stove , being careful not to destroy all the good stuff by warming it up too much, until I get the desired heat.  I then strain the honey.  People love it.  At Thanksgiving, the teenagers were eating it on the turkey.

Caroldahling:
I have long sought a way to preserve the scent of gardenias. No luck with oils or tinctures, but with honey?  Oh yes. That delightful scent is perfect! 
I also enjoy adding a single madagascar vanilla bean and a real cinnamon stick to a jar. Perfect every time. The cinnamon is just strong enough to use for a lip plumper or in tea.
